Explanation:
The GENERATION EFFECT is a phenomenon in Psychology explaining the tendency to remember information if it is generated from one's mind as opposed to simply being read.
For example, you are more likely to remember the word Debauchery if you had to fill it in like De_a_c_e_y.
This explains why those who simply read words in the above study were not as capable in reminiscence as the group that had to fill in the second word.
